*Flash Stage 2 APR TCU tune to Stock
-----> So I can flash on a unitronic stage 2 TCU tune. From all I've read, unitronic's TCU tune is simply smoother, a little less harsh, but still offers the same top end performance. Worth a try for the money back gaurantee, because the behaviour of the DSG (which I am hoping is a product of the APR tune) is just not enjoyable in stop and go.
* Downshifts clunky, mostly in 2nd and 3rd
* Stopping feels very non-linear; you feel the gears moving down and the car just doesn't feel good doing it. Wish there was some sort of 'neutral' mode it would go into lol
* From a stop, lots of vibrations, which i expect with full mounts, but also that damn delay.
Unitronic appears, based off the few reviews I could find, to simply be smoother across the board and soften alot of the downfalls that the DSG 'just has'. Will report back!

Well, update.
Got the unitronic dsg tune flashed. Unfortunately I can't they any remarkable improvement in smoothness. Just the mechanical reality if the day is the downshift clanks and such.
Starting off feels a little better however, no lurching. Feels like when I take my foot off the brake it's already engaged ready to go. That said, I guess I didn't mind a split second delay and just waiting to hit the gas.
Probably will flash back to apr and return the tune.
